Position Summary
Support the successful planning, coordination, and execution of public works and school construction projects throughout California. The Project Engineer works closely with Project Managers and Superintendents to ensure project documentation, communication, scheduling, and field coordination are effectively managed from preconstruction through project closeout.
Key Responsibilities
  • Assist Project Managers and Superintendents with day-to-day project operations and coordination.
  • Manage RFIs, submittals, ASIs, change orders, drawing updates, and project documentation.
  • Coordinate communication between subcontractors, vendors, consultants, architects, inspectors, and owners.
  • Maintain accurate project logs, meeting minutes, and document control procedures.
  • Track procurement schedules and long-lead material deliveries to support project timelines.
  • Assist with project budgeting, cost tracking, and invoice processing.
  • Participate in owner meetings, subcontractor meetings, and project coordination meetings.
  • Review plans, specifications, and contract documents for completeness, constructability, and DSA compliance.
  • Support field operations to ensure project information is communicated clearly and implemented properly.
  • Coordinate with DSA inspectors, testing agencies, and public agencies throughout all phases of construction.
  • Assist with project closeout including punch lists, warranties, as-built drawings, and turnover documentation.
  • Ensure compliance with DSA requirements, public works regulations, OSHA safety standards, and company policies.
  • Promote a professional, team-oriented environment focused on accountability and continuous improvement.
